Bangladesh To Vote Tomorrow Amid Opposition Parties' Boycott

In a few hours, the electorate in Bangladesh will vote to elect new MPs amidst a boycott call from the main Opposition party and incidents of violence even before the first vote has been cast. NDTV reports from Dhaka as Bangladesh votes in its 12th general election.
